At Prudhoe Station, convenience is key, even though you won’t find a traditional ticket office here. Instead, passengers are welcomed by user-friendly ticket machines that allow for the easy collection of tickets purchased online. These machines are conveniently accessible for everyone, providing card-only transactions for a seamless experience. While the station may lack a staff presence, help is still at hand via a dedicated helpline numbered 08002006060, where trained advisors are ready to assist with any queries.
Accessibility is thoughtfully integrated, with step-free access available to both platforms via a level crossing, ensuring a smooth transition from arrival to departure. Furthermore, passengers who are traveling in wheelchairs or require added assistance can feel at ease knowing that the station caters to their needs.
Prudhoe Station isn't just a point of departure—it's a hub of connectivity. With bus services operating nearby and a taxi service facilitated through Northern's Cab4You, getting to and from the station couldn't be easier. Should the need arise for rail replacement services, they're conveniently located at the bus interchange in the station's car park. For those favoring a more adventurous route, consider pedaling through the surrounding area, though note that bicycle hire isn't available from the station itself.

Yeovil Junction is well-equipped to help you kick off your journey with ease. The station operates a ticket office open from 06:00 to 19:20 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:55 to 18:25 on Sundays. For added convenience, ticket machines are accessible and include options for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making it easier to plan ahead and collect tickets purchased online.
There are several customer service amenities available. While the station lacks luggage storage services, it does have CCTV and customer help points to ensure safety and timely assistance. Furthermore, public Wi-Fi is accessible, and a helpful refreshment café is also available if you wish to grab a coffee before your journey.
Yeovil Junction connects you to various transport links. If a rail replacement service is needed, it's conveniently located at the station car park off Newton Road. For more detailed bus connections, travelers can find printable journey plans here, ensuring you don't miss out on local explorations.
Though there are no cycle hire facilities, bike storage is available with 16 spaces monitored by CCTV. For those driving to the station, parking options abound with 197 spaces, including six accessible spots, all available through RingGo's easy-to-use service.
